Upgrade from 3.0.5 to most recent version

I have a system using 3.0.5 version and I would like to migrate it to recent version but I can't find documentations how to do that.
I found the documentation but it start from 3.5 version :frowning:

Is there a way to do the migration?


3.0.5 Neo4j 3.0.5 - Graph Database & Analytics was released 9 September 2016 and now some 7 yr later you want to upgrade to v5? Thats a fairly large jump and with a great number of changes.

As to how to get from v3.0.x to v3.5 and given 3.5.0 was released Neo4j 3.5.0 - Graph Database & Analytics 29 November 2018, and some 5+ yrs ago maybe follow steps as described at Unable to Upgrade to v4.0.0 from v3.0.1 (Community Edition)

Migrate 3.5 - Upgrade and Migration Guide describes how to migrate from v3.5.x to v4.4.x

and then once on v4.4.x you can use

Migrate databases from 4.4 - Upgrade and Migration Guide to migrate from v4.4.x to v5.x

given you have not upgraded the software in 7+ yrs, this is going to take a fair amount of effort

Thank you so much, I will try the way you mention and I will let you know how is going.
Yes, I know it will take a big effort changing the version and the code in my app :frowning:

Did you find a solution? I want to migrate from Neo4j Community Edition 3.1.3 to a version that supports Graph Data Science.

Hi, yes, I did,
I just folow the topics @dana_canzano mentioned in his comment,
You can find some versions of Neo4j, here you download the version

Download the versions you need. Folow the instructions in the links. In my case I did not have issues migrating between versions

1 Like

Thank you so much , I'll give it a shot.

I am absolutely new in neo4j and I am trying to migrate from neo4j v3.1 into v4.4.9 or later I checked the documentation but I didn't figure out anything or find documentation describing step by step the process so please if you can give me the step by step?